About 2-[(4-chlorophenyl)sulfonylamino]-N-(3,4-dihydro-2H-1,5-benzodioxepin-7-yl)propanamide
2-[(4-chlorophenyl)sulfonylamino]-N-(3,4-dihydro-2H-1,5-benzodioxepin-7-yl)propanamide (PubChem CID 55350091) has the molecular formula C18H19ClN2O5S
and a molecular weight of 410.88 g/mol. Its IUPAC name is 2-[(4-chlorophenyl)sulfonylamino]-N-(3,4-dihydro-2H-1,5-benzodioxepin-7-yl)propanamide.

What is the SMILES notation for 2-[(4-chlorophenyl)sulfonylamino]-N-(3,4-dihydro-2H-1,5-benzodioxepin-7-yl)propanamide?
The canonical SMILES for 2-[(4-chlorophenyl)sulfonylamino]-N-(3,4-dihydro-2H-1,5-benzodioxepin-7-yl)propanamide is CC(NS(=O)(=O)c1ccc(Cl)cc1)C(=O)Nc1ccc2c(c1)OCCCO2.
What is the InChIKey of 2-[(4-chlorophenyl)sulfonylamino]-N-(3,4-dihydro-2H-1,5-benzodioxepin-7-yl)propanamide?
The InChIKey is RVDJHJPLVOWDLM-UHFFFAOYSA-N. The full InChI is InChI=1S/C18H19ClN2O5S/c1-12(21-27(23,24)15-6-3-13(19)4-7-15)18(22)20-14-5-8-16-17(11-14)26-10-2-9-25-16/h3-8,11-12,21H,2,9-10H2,1H3,(H,20,22).
What are the key properties of 2-[(4-chlorophenyl)sulfonylamino]-N-(3,4-dihydro-2H-1,5-benzodioxepin-7-yl)propanamide?
2-[(4-chlorophenyl)sulfonylamino]-N-(3,4-dihydro-2H-1,5-benzodioxepin-7-yl)propanamide has a molecular weight of 410.88 g/mol, XLogP of 2.81, 5 rotatable bonds, 2 hydrogen bond donors, and 5 hydrogen bond acceptors.
